Webb4 maj 2024 · Key Takeaways. I Bonds and TIPS are investments that protect your principal and purchasing power. Individuals can only buy $10,000 worth of I Bonds in a single calendar year, while $5 million in TIPS can be purchased at any single auction. You can sell TIPS anytime you want, but you can't sell I Bonds for at least a year after … Webb1 nov. 2024 · Semi-annual Inflation Rates. composite rate = fixed rate + ( 2 X inflation rate ) + ( fixed rate X inflation rate )
